Blanchard Valley Hospital's (BVH) Vascular Laboratory has been reaccredited by the Intersocietal Accreditation Commission (IAC). The vascular lab uses non- invasive ultrasound testing to help diagnose a variety of vascular conditions.
This accreditation recognizes labs that provide a high level of patient care and quality testing when diagnosing vascular disease. To receive accreditation, BVH underwent detailed evaluations of facility operations and a comprehensive application process. The accreditation is valid for three years.

The Park District invites Icon viewers to attend an informational meeting at 10 a.m., Saturday, April 22, at the Ada Depot, according to Bryan Marshall.
The park district (Park District Liberty Township, Hardin County, Ada War Memorial Park) will hold the meeting to provide information concerning the park board’s application for a NatureWorks 2017 grant.
The grant will assist in the costs of resurfacing the tennis courts at the park.
The grant will provide up to 75 percent reimbursement assistance toward the project. The remaining 25 percent will come from local funding.
